<p><a href="http://brandi-annuyemura.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/DSC07232.jpg#utm_source=feed&amp;utm_medium=feed&amp;utm_campaign=feed"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-715" style="border: 1px solid black;" title="Antique_Typewriter" src="http://brandi-annuyemura.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/DSC07232-225x300.jpg" alt="" width="203" height="270" /></a>Ever wonder what the &#8220;free&#8221; in freelance writer stands for? Is it free for freedom? Or free as in non-paying?</p>
<p>According to Dictionary.com, the word came from the 1820s meaning medieval mercenary warrior. And later referring to journalism in 1882. What a long way we&#8217;ve come from the original meaning. Or have we?</p>
<p>As freelance writers, we&#8217;re closer to a mercenary warrior (a courageous one who works for pay) then one that works for free, aren&#8217;t we?</p>
<p>Yet, I&#8217;m noticing more and more job ads requiring freelancers to write &#8220;on spec&#8221; (essentially for free) first.</p>
<h3>MY CONFESSION:</h3>
<p>I&#8217;ve been guilty of applying for several of these jobs. Jobs that ask me to write a blog or a short article for free. I&#8217;m always one of the top candidates when I&#8217;m asked to do yet another sample. And the end result? I typically don&#8217;t get the job.</p>
